EMB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2016 in Review

322 of the 3,753 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ares JPMorgan USD Emerging Markets Bond ETF (EMB) for Q1 2016, worth a combined $4.12B — up 42% from $2.9B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 55 funds opened new EMB positions and 38 closed out — a net gain of 17 holders — while 110 added to existing stakes and 118 trimmed.

The largest buyer was JP Morgan Chase, adding an estimated $334M. The largest seller was Grimes & Company, exiting entirely with an estimated $41.2M sold.
